Every inspection of Priory Gardens
6 rated inspections over 4 years: the service has improved, from Requires improvement to Good.
- December 2020Inspected but not ratedcurrent ratingSafe: Inspected but not rated
- March 2019Goodup from InadequateSafe: GoodEffective: GoodCaring: GoodResponsive: GoodWell-led: Good
- August 2018Inadequatedown from Requires improvementSafe: InadequateEffective: Requires improvementCaring: Requires improvementResponsive: Requires improvementWell-led: Inadequate
- May 2017Requires improvementup from InadequateSafe: Requires improvementEffective: Requires improvementCaring: Requires improvementResponsive: Requires improvementWell-led: Requires improvement
- September 2016Inadequatedown from Requires improvementSafe: InadequateEffective: Requires improvementCaring: GoodResponsive: Requires improvementWell-led: Inadequate
- December 2015Requires improvementstayed Requires improvementSafe: Requires improvementEffective: Requires improvementCaring: GoodResponsive: Requires improvementWell-led: Good
- November 2014Requires improvementSafe: Requires improvementEffective: Requires improvementCaring: GoodResponsive: Requires improvementWell-led: Good
